Bryan Texana Foundation is located in Houston, TX. The organization was established in 1995. According to its NTEE Classification (A54) the organization is classified as: History Museums, under the broad grouping of Arts, Culture & Humanities and related organizations. As of 11/2022, Bryan Texana Foundation employed 38 individuals. This organization is an independent organization and not affiliated with a larger national or regional group of organizations. Bryan Texana Foundation is a 501(c)(3) and as such, is described as a "Charitable or Religous organization or a private foundation" by the IRS.
For the year ending 11/2022, Bryan Texana Foundation generated $2.6m in total revenue. This represents a relatively dramatic decline in revenue. Over the past 4 years, the organization has seen revenues fall by an average of (5.9%) each year. All expenses for the organization totaled $3.4m during the year ending 11/2022. As we would expect to see with falling revenues, expenses have declined by (0.5%) per year over the past 4 years. Describe the Organization's Mission:
Part 3 - Line 1
THE MISSION OF THE BRYAN MUSEUM IS TO BRING THE HISTORY OF TEXAS AND THE AMERICAN WEST TO LIFE. THROUGH ITS WORLD-CLASS COLLECTIONS, EXHIBITIONS, AND EDUCATIONAL HISTORY AND LITERACY PROGRAMS, STUDENTS OF ALL AGES GET A CHANCE TO EXPERIENCE THE STORIES OF YESTERDAY AND WRITE THE STORIES OF TOMORROW.
Describe the Organization's Program Activity:
THE BRYAN MUSEUM HOUSES ITS ONE-OF-A-KIND COLLECTION OF MORE THAN 70,000 ARTIFACTS, ART, MAPS, BOOKS, AND ORIGINAL DOCUMENTS IN THE HISTORIC FORMER GALVESTON ORPHANS HOME. HISTORY AND LITERACY FOCUSED INITIATIVES INCLUDE FREE COMMUNITY PROGRAMS, ADULT LECTURES, EXHIBITIONS, SUMMER CAMPS FOR KIDS, SPECIAL TOURS, AND SCHOOL TOURS FOR ALL GRADE LEVELS THAT COMPLEMENT FOURTH AND SEVENTH GRADE TEXAS HISTORY CURRICULUMS. IN ADDITION, THE ORGANIZATION TRAVELS MULTIPLE EDUCATIONAL EXHIBITS TO SCHOOL AND MUSEUM PARTNERS, HOSTS ANNUAL TEXAS HISTORY-BASED LITERACY AND PUBLISHING COMPETITIONS, SUPPLIES A CURRICULUM AND ONLINE RESOURCES TO EDUCATORS, PROVIDES HANDS-ON LEARNING EXPERIENCES, AND IS OFFICIALLY HOME TO THE LARGEST PUBLISHED BOOK IN THE WORLD BY KIDS CALLED I AM TEXAS, BREAKING A GUINNESS WORLD RECORD.
